Jamestown,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Jamestown?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jamestown 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,726 | $1,100 | $2,400 |
Jamestown 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,035 | $250 | $3,750 |
Jamestown 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,375 | $3,250 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jamestown
What type of rentals are currently available in Jamestown?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Jamestown,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,025 to $2,900. There are also 39 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Jamestown ranging from $250 to $5,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Jamestown?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Jamestown ranges from $250 to $5,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,296.
